From: Frank L. <fra...@go...> - 2009-09-29 15:24:37
|
2009/9/29 HAT <ha...@fa...>: > Hi, > > On Mon, 14 Sep 2009 13:54:23 +0200 > Frank Lahm <fra...@go...> wrote: > >> So remains the options of re-using one of the unused entries which >> aren't used at all in our code: >> >> #define ADEID_ICONBW 5 >> #define ADEID_ICONCOL 6 >> ... >> #define ADEID_MACFILEI 10 /* we don't use this */ >> ... >> #define ADEID_MSDOSFILEI 12 /* we don't use this */ > > It is never permitted. > Original entry ID must be larger than 0x7FFFFFFF. Right. As said, I'm now implementing another approach as described. > Example: > - client created file "fileWithEAs" which has two EAs named > "com.apples.organges" and "com.oranges.apples". > > On the server this would be stored like this: > > $ ls -a . > fileWithEAs .AppleDouble > $ ls -l .AppleDoubke > fileWithEAs > fileWithEAs::EA > fileWithEAs::EA::com.apples.organges > fileWithEAs::EA::com.oranges.apples -Frank |